Since SolveIT's computer software prevents Windows updates from happening automatically, some system and driver updates will not be automatic either. We can use HP's image assistant program to bypass this and manually install updates. These are for the system's firmware and driver updates, not for Windows updates.


  1. Go to this link and download the latest version of the software. While you install it, it will open several File Explorer windows and command prompts, ignore these, the software will load on its own once it is fully installed in minutes.
  2. Once it loads, it will have the default Target be This Computer from the Reference Image from HP.com. Click on the Analyze button and let it sit for a few minutes.
  3. After it scans your PC for outdated software, it will display this in a new view. In the middle of the view, it shows you how many outdated or missing drivers you may have, click on any of the 2 numbers there.
  4. A new view will appear again, this is a list of all the outdated or missing drivers it wants you to download and install. You do not need to check off all of them. Leave HP Smart Health and System Default settings unchecked, they are not needed. Do check off the others, including the BIOS update, your list may look different than this example image. Then click the blue Download button.
  5. Another window will appear. Under the Operation section, click on the second bullet point for Download/extract/install, then click Start. Let this sit for a few minutes. Some command prompts and other windows may appear and vanish as it installs the software. 
  6. Once it is finished, it will open a tab in your browser to tell you what it installed and if any failed. Restart your PC and let it run the final updates, including the BIOS updates. Do not unplug your PC or force it to shut down. This process may take 30 minutes, it is best to do this at the end of the day, or outside business hours. Once it is finished completely, it will reboot and launch Windows normally.
